NCT ID: NCT00765752 Completed - Insomnia Clinical Trials

Cortical GABA Concentrations in Insomnia

Start date: November 2007
Phase: N/A
Study type: Observational

Disturbances in the amino acid neurotransmitter (AANt), gamma-amino butyric acid (GABA) function are hypothesized to contribute to the neurobiology of Major Depressive Disorder (MDD) and insomnia. The principal objective of this project is to use magnetic resonance spectroscopy (MRS) to provide the first in vivo characterization of cortical GABA levels in individuals with primary insomnia, and to determine whether subjects with MDD, achieving a partial response with selective serotonin reuptake inhibitor treatment but still experiencing significant residual symptoms including insomnia, have altered levels of this neurotransmitter. The investigators are also exploring the correlation between cortical AANt levels and abnormalities in sleep parameters in primary insomnia and as a residual symptom of major depression.

NCT ID: NCT00704860 Completed - Major Depression Clinical Trials

Treatment-Resistant Depression, Hippocampus Atrophy and Serotonin Genetic Polymorphism

Start date: February 2005
Phase: Phase 4
Study type: Interventional

Reduction of volume of the hippocampus has been associated with major depression in many studies. It has been suggested that antidepressants may protect against hippocampus volume loss in humans associated with multiple episodes of depression and may also reverse the reduction of volume caused by the depression. In addition, genetic markers for serotonin are implicated with depression, and may be an indication of reduced response to antidepressant treatments. This study aims to enroll patients who are defined as having treatment resistant depression (no remission after at least 2 treatments trials with an antidepressant). They will receive an MRI scan at the initial visit and either 6 months after sustained remission or 12 months after they enter the study for non-remitters. They will also be asked to give a blood sample for genotyping. They will be matched by age and handedness to healthy volunteers with no personal history of depression who will also receive an MRI scan and genotyping. The first aim is to compare hippocampal volume of depressed subjects to healthy controls. It is anticipated that subjects will initially have smaller hippocampal volume but of those who sustain remission, there will be a small increase in hippocampal volume. It is also anticipated that specific genetic markers will be related to individuals response to antidepressant treatments.

NCT ID: NCT00695552 Terminated - Major Depression Clinical Trials

The Effect of Exercise on Depressive Symptoms in Unmedicated Patients

DEMOII
Start date: September 2008
Phase: N/A
Study type: Interventional

This trial investigates the biological effect of exercise training on depression. Participants will randomly be allocated to either a aerobic exercise group performing exercise on stationary bikes or a group performing low-impact exercise such as stretching exercises. Both groups will attend sessions three times per week for 3 months. Before and after the intervention the investigators will measure the severity of depression using the Hamilton depression rating scale (HAM-D17).

NCT ID: NCT00675896 Completed - Major Depression Clinical Trials

A Study of Quetiapine Fumarate Sustained Release in Major Depression With Comorbid Fibromyalgia Syndrome

Start date: April 2007
Phase: Phase 4
Study type: Interventional

To compare the efficacy of Quetiapine SR versus placebo over 8 weeks in unipolar non-psychotic adult outpatients depression and comorbid fibromyalgia. This will be measured by the last observation carried forward (LOCF) mean change from baseline to week 8 on the Hamilton Depression Scale (HAM-D) total score. For the purposes of this study, response regarding improvement in depressive symptoms will be defined as a 50% decrease in HAM-D scores over 8 weeks. Furthermore, proportion of patients achieving remission is defined as an HAM-D total score of 7 at end of treatment. The anxiety comorbid symptoms often associated with major depression will be assessed with the HAM-A (14 items) scale. Proportion of patients responding and achieving remission of anxiety symptoms are defined respectively as a reduction of 50% in the HAM-A total score from baseline and a HAM-A total score of 7 at the end of treatment.
